Ordinals
beta
Address bc1qe664xg2lxmlyl98mm2reqv5zflh6nk8ggufvnw
sat balance
401047
runes balances
outputs
58b99d3b7c84cd6a930d644c51b0ac57ddb211834d915473314e7489e9c85766:0